在这个数字化时代,网站已经成为企业和个人展示形象、传播信息的重要平台。对于新手来说,选择一个合适的DIY前端框架来构建和维护网站至关重要。本文将为你详细解析如何选择合适的前端框架,让你轻松应对网站维护的挑战。
了解前端框架的基本概念
1. 什么是前端框架?
前端框架是一套预定义的代码规范和组件库,旨在提高前端开发的效率和质量。它提供了一套标准化的开发流程和工具,帮助开发者快速构建响应式、交互性强的网页。
2. 常见的前端框架
目前市场上主流的前端框架有Bootstrap、Foundation、jQuery、React、Vue等。每个框架都有其独特的特点和适用场景。
选择前端框架的考虑因素
1. 项目需求
在选择前端框架之前,首先要明确项目的需求。以下是一些需要考虑的因素:
a. 网站类型
不同类型的网站对前端框架的需求不同。例如,企业官网、个人博客、电商平台等,应根据网站的特点选择合适的框架。
b. 开发周期
项目开发周期是选择框架的重要参考。对于时间紧迫的项目,应选择易于上手、文档丰富的框架。
c. 团队技能
团队对前端框架的熟悉程度也会影响选择。如果团队成员对某个框架较为熟悉,可以优先考虑该框架。
2. 框架特点
以下是一些常见前端框架的特点,供你参考:
a. Bootstrap
- 优点:响应式布局、组件丰富、易于上手
- 缺点:代码体积较大、定制性较低
b. Foundation
- 优点:响应式布局、组件丰富、高度可定制
- 缺点:学习曲线较陡峭、文档不够完善
c. jQuery
- 优点:轻量级、易于上手、插件丰富
- 缺点:性能较差、缺乏响应式布局支持
d. React
- 优点:组件化开发、高性能、生态系统完善
- 缺点:学习曲线较陡峭、性能优化难度较大
e. Vue
- 优点:易学易用、文档完善、社区活跃
- 缺点:性能较React略低、生态系统相对较小
3. 社区支持和文档
一个活跃的社区和完善的文档对于新手来说至关重要。选择一个社区支持好的框架,可以让你在遇到问题时获得更多帮助。
如何轻松维护网站
1. 代码规范
遵循代码规范可以让你在后期维护时更容易理解代码,提高开发效率。
2. 版本控制
使用版本控制系统(如Git)可以方便地管理代码变更,防止代码丢失。
3. 持续集成
通过持续集成工具(如Jenkins)可以自动化测试和部署,提高网站稳定性。
4. 监控和优化
定期对网站进行监控和优化,可以提升用户体验和网站性能。
总结
选择合适的前端框架对于新手来说至关重要。通过了解框架的基本概念、考虑项目需求和框架特点,你可以轻松找到适合自己的框架。同时,遵循代码规范、使用版本控制和持续集成等工具,可以让你在后期维护网站时更加得心应手。希望本文能对你有所帮助!
